Ingredients
- 1 cup (225 g) un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up (200 g) granulated sugar
- 0.25 cup (50 g) light brown sugar, packed
- 2 large eggs
- 1 tsp (5 ml) alcohol-free vanilla extract
- 0.5 tsp (2.5 ml) food-grade rosewater
- 2.5 cups (300 g) all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p (5 ml) cream of tartar
- 0.5 tsp (2.5 ml) baking soda
- 0.5 tsp (2.5 ml) fine sea salt
- 0.5 tsp (2.5 ml) ground cinnamon
- 1 tsp (5 ml) ground green cardamom (for dough)
- 0.25 cup (60 g) granulated sugar (for rolling)
- 1 tsp (5 ml) ground green cardamom (for rolling)
- 0.25 cup (30 g) finely ground pistachios, for garnish (optional)
Instructions
- Cream Butter And Sugars: In a large bowl, cream softened unsalted butter, 200g granulated sugar, and light brown sugar with an electric mixer for 2-3 minutes until light, fluffy, and pale yellow.
- Add Eggs And Flavorings: Beat in eggs one at a time, fully incorporating each. Stir in alcohol-free vanilla extract and food-grade rosewater until combined and fragrant.
- Combine Dry Ingredients: In a separate medium bowl, whisk together flour, cream of tartar,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, and 1 tsp cardamom until thoroughly combined.
- Mix Dough And Chill: Gradually add dry ingredients to wet, mixing on low speed until just combined and a soft dough forms. Do not overmix. Chill dough in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es to firm up and prevent spread. (If your dough seems too dry after chilling, add a tablespoon of milk to loosen it slightly before rolling.)
- Prepare Oven And Rolling Mixture: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. In a shallow dish, combine 60g granulated sugar and 5 ml green cardamom for the rolling mixture until aromatic.
- Form And Coat Cookies: Scoop dough by tablespoonfuls (about 25-30 g each), roll into smooth balls. Generously coat each dough ball in the cardamom-sugar mixture.
- Bake Cookies: Place coated dough balls about 2 inches (5 cm) apart on the baking sheet. Bake for 8-10 minutes, until edges are lightly golden and centers are set but soft, with cracked surfaces.
- Cool And Serve: Remove from oven, cool on baking sheet for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ely. Garnish with finely ground pistachios if desired.
Notes
For a less sweet snickerdoodle recipe, you can slightly reduce the granulated sugar in the dough by 25-50g. Always ensure your cream of tartar is fresh; old cream of tartar can lead to flat cookies.
